From Isolation is the second studio album from Call to Preserve. Facedown Records released the album on September 30, 2008.

Critical reception

More information Review scores, Source ...

Awarding the album three and a half stars from AllMusic, Cosmo Lee states, "Despite its stylistic straitjacket, this record packs a punch."[1] Seamus Bradley, rating the album a seven out of ten for Cross Rhythms, writes, "All in all this is a solid album from a solid band."[2] Giving the album two and a half stars at Jesus Freak Hideout, Timothy Estabrooks describes, "From Isolation is not a great album. There is very little musical creativity or variation and it drags somewhat even with its short length. However, it is also not a terrible album."[3]
